How long can I grow with the same Metal Halide lamp?

How long can I grow Pepperplants under the same MH until the plants wont grow on (The MH wont work for the plants)?

How big could be the plants if they'll be every day 16 hours for 6 - 8 months under the MH?

1) MH will always be effective; but will lose lumes once its turned on. You can't really judge how rapidly as it varies bulb to bulb. There are luxometers for sale to see how you bulb is producing. On average I have come across number such as 15 percent loss over 2 years for cheaper bulbs 4 year for higher quality. I have been running a digilux 400w MH for 16/8 for 4.5 months and my buddies luxometer says it is still throwing out 43,500 lumens. Remember you may have to convert lux to lumen.

2) How big will you plants get... depends on the plant... some of mine are over three feet after 4.5 months.
 
A metal halide is all you need. It is not a mtter of how long or how many plants it is a matter of square foot. A 400watt MH light will give you a 3'x3' area or so. The higher the watt the more spread.
